Pulwama: Amid the restrictions imposed by the authorities, clashes broke out in South Kashmir’s Pulwama district after the locals staged a protest against the recent civilian killings.
Soon after the culmination of congregational Friday prayers, people from Jamia Masjid Pulwama marched towards the district headquarters amid raising slogans against civilian killings and demanding action against the forces involved in recent civilian killing at SirnooPulwama.
Notably, Pulwama observed complete shutdown for the seventh consecutive day today.
All the shops, business establishments, colleges and coaching centres remained closed in the town for the seventh consecutive day while as public transport also remained off the roads.
Reports said that protest rallies were also taken at Murran and Rohmoo as well after Friday prayers.
Locals informed ‘Kashmir Vision’ that the religious clerics denounced the civilian killings in Pulwama during the congregational Friday prayers.
While protests were going on main chowk, clashes erupted in Malikpora area of Pulwama when youth pelted stones on government forces, which was retaliated by tear smoke shells.
Pertinently, three militants and an army man were killed in a gunfight in Sirnoo village of district Pulwama following which seven civilians were killed in post gunfight clashes that left dozens of people injured as well.
